A Hopf texture is a vacuum field configuration of isovector fields which is an onto map from the space as a large three sphere to the vacuum manifold $S^2$. We construct a Hopf texture with spherically symmetric energy density and discuss the topological charge. A Hopf texture collapses, and we study the collapse process numerically. In our simulations, it is clear that a Hopf texture does not decay into a pair of monopoles. We also argue that the probability of forming Hopf textures in random processes is very small compared to that of global monopoles.
